The Historical Significance of the British Flag
The British Flag, also known as the Union Jack, is a composite of three national flags: the crosses of St. George (England), St. Andrew (Scotland), and St. Patrick (Ireland). The design reflects the historical union of these nations under the British Crown. The flagβs creation dates back to the 17th century, with its current form being officially adopted in 1801. The Union Jack is a powerful symbol of unity and sovereignty, representing the collective identity of the British people.
